The main objective of Enbridge stock analysis is to determine its intrinsic value, which is an estimate of what Enbridge is worth, separate from its market price. There are two main types of Enbridge's stock analysis: fundamental analysis and technical analysis. Fundamental analysis focuses on the financial and economic factors that affect Enbridge's performance, such as revenue growth, earnings, and financial stability. Technical analysis, on the other hand, focuses on the price and volume data of Enbridge's stock to identify patterns and trends that may indicate its future price movements.
The Enbridge stock is traded in Canada on Toronto Exchange, with the market opening at 09:30:00 and closing at 16:00:00 every Mon,Tue,Wed,Thu,Fri except for officially observed holidays in Canada. Enbridge is usually not traded on Christmas Day, Boxing Day, New Year 's Day, Family Day, Good Friday, Victoria Day, Canada Day, Civic Holiday, Labour Day, Thanksgiving Day. Enbridge Stock trading window is adjusted to America/Toronto timezone. The company operates through five segments Liquids Pipelines, Gas Transmission and Midstream, Gas Distribution and Storage, Renewable Power Generation, and Energy Services. Enbridge Inc. was founded in 1949 and is headquartered in Calgary, Canada. ENBRIDGE INC operates under Oil Gas Midstream classification in Canada and is traded on Toronto Stock Exchange. The output start index for this execution was twenty-nine with a total number of output elements of thirty-two. The Bollinger Bands is very popular indicator that was developed by John Bollinger. It consist of three lines. Enbridge middle band is a simple moving average of its typical price. The upper and lower bands are (N) standard deviations above and below the middle band. The bands widen and narrow when the volatility of the price is higher or lower, respectively. The upper and lower bands can also be interpreted as price targets for Enbridge. When the price bounces off of the lower band and crosses the middle band, then the upper band becomes the price target.

Enbridge's time-series forecasting models are one of many Enbridge's stock analysis techniques aimed at predicting future share value based on previously observed values. Time-series forecasting models ae widely used for non-stationary data. Non-stationary data are called the data whose statistical properties e.g. the mean and standard deviation are not constant over time but instead, these metrics vary over time. These non-stationary Enbridge's historical data is usually called time-series. Some empirical experimentation suggests that the statistical forecasting models outperform the models based exclusively on fundamental analysis to predict the direction of the market movement and maximize returns from investment trading.
